Cardiff Council will be making improvements to Trowbridge Green with the aim of making a better environment for people to live in.

In 2021, we consulted with local residents to find local priorities for the area. Highlighted during the consultation was:

  • Condition of the footpaths
  • Speed of vehicles
  • Condition of the courtyards

In response to these concerns, the proposed works include:

  • Upgrade of pedestrian pathways throughout the estate
  • Environmental improvements to the public realm
  • Implementing traffic calming measures
  • Upgrade of front and rear boundaries (including gates)

Courtyard improvements:

  • New surfacing,
  • New bin stores,
  • Increased security
  • New provision for drying clothes

Current status

I am pleased to share that Knights Brown has been chosen as the principle contractor. Works will begin in November, and will be completed in the summer 2026. You will be notified when works in your immediate area are due to commence.

We appreciate that, unavoidably, the works are likely to cause a level of inconvenience for residents. However, the Council and the appointed contractor will ensure that disruption will be keep to a minimum as we work towards creating a better environment for the local community.
